"confusion": {
"description": "原生混淆",
"resources": {
"utils/crypto.js" : {} // 混淆文件
}
},
- 发布:2025-05-01 15:48
- 更新:2025-11-20 11:46
- 阅读:2306
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: win11
HBuilderX类型: 正式
HBuilderX版本号: 4.57
手机系统: Android
手机系统版本号: Android 15
手机厂商: IQOO
手机机型: IQOO NEO9
页面类型: vue
vue版本: vue3
打包方式: 云端
项目创建方式: HBuilderX
示例代码:
操作步骤:
VUE3原生混淆js后云打包
VUE3原生混淆js后云打包
预期结果:
成功混淆并打包
成功混淆并打包
实际结果:
Error code = -5000
Error message:
Error: confusion failed!
file not exist: app-confusion.js
Error code = -5000
Error message:
Error: confusion failed!
file not exist: app-confusion.js
bug描述:
Appid: XXX
Error code = -5000
Error message:
Error: confusion failed!
file not exist: app-confusion.js
2 个回复
风之源 - 大肠包小肠
所以file not exist: app-confusion.js不是你项目的文件吗
DCloud_App_Array
重新提交云端打包,提供appid,我们查下云端打包日志。
3***@qq.com
我也遇到了一样的问题,请问是什么原因呢
2025-08-02 19:35
DCloud_App_Array
回复 3***@qq.com: 请提供云端打包错误日志链接地址
2025-08-04 15:36
上玄 (作者)
用4.75的编译器又可以了(vue3)
2025-08-11 23:57
3***@qq.com
回复 DCloud_App_Array: 我也遇到了同样的问题
2025-11-17 16:57
3***@qq.com
回复 DCloud_App_Array: https://app.liuyingyong.cn/build/errorLog/f4605650-c398-11f0-a4e2-67e2defb7e7b
2025-11-17 18:21
DCloud_云服务_Mal
回复 3***@qq.com: 配置原生混淆时,不能使用安心打包,要使用“传统打包”模式。
2025-11-18 15:41
3***@qq.com
回复 DCloud_云服务_Mal: 那配置原生混淆且安心打包成功了,是什么情况,混淆生效吗
2025-11-20 10:34
3***@qq.com
回复 DCloud_云服务_Mal: https://app.liuyingyong.cn/build/errorLog/2d5bb910-c5be-11f0-a886-71661c4bcf52,选择传统打包还是打包失败
2025-11-20 11:46
DCloud_云服务_Mal
回复 3***@qq.com: 不是安心打包的问题,是配置的混淆文件不存在,导致编译后未能正确生成混淆配置导致的。
2025-11-20 15:37